Output dde076d58531c6490dc59689d29c7fe7d04bf6e72bb90dc59c54faa6d7aaec18:1

value
908502385
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51abfd9a657c72864df97c57a2253309c8306408 OP_EQUALVERIFY OP_CHECKSIG
address
18Sqmf7w3iU2NXiVXi3PM2fXuCraaAr8XD
transaction
dde076d58531c6490dc59689d29c7fe7d04bf6e72bb90dc59c54faa6d7aaec18
confirmations
371728
spent
true